Step 1: Initial Assessment
Our team will inspect the affected area to find out the extent of the damage and identify the source of the problem. This critical step helps us develop an effective plan to restore your property. Don’t worry, we’ll take care of the heavy lifting and ensure your safety throughout the process.
Step 2: Water Removal and Extraction
Using high-powered pumps and vacuum equipment our team will extract as much water as possible from the affected area. This efficient process helps prevent further damage and reduces the risk of mold growth.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
After the initial water removal, we’ll employ industrial-grade drying equipment to dry the affected area thoroughly. This critical step helps prevent the growth of mold and mildew, ensuring your property is safe and healthy.
Step 4: Sanitization and Disinfecting
To ensure your property is safe and healthy, we’ll thoroughly sanitize and disinfect the affected area. This important step helps remove any remaining bacteria and contaminants.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Restoration
Once the drying and sanitization process is complete, our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ure your property is safe and secure. We’ll also provide you with a comprehensive report of the work completed, including any necessary repairs or recommendations for future prevention.

Tree Root Pipe Damage Water Removal Cost in Hendersonville, TN
The cost of Tree Root Pipe Damage Water Removal in Hendersonville, TN can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our team provides accurate estimates and clear communication throughout the process. You can expect to pay anywhere from $500 to $2,500 or more, depending on the extent of the damage.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Assessment and Inspection | $100-$300 | The size of the affected area and the complexity of the damage |
| Water Removal and Extraction | $500-$2,000 | The amount of water to be removed and the equipment needed |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$500-$1,500 | The size of the affected area and the type of equipment used |
| Sanitization and Disinfecting | $200-$500 | The size of the affected area and the level of contamination |
| Final Inspection and Restoration | $100-$300 | The complexity of the damage and the level of restoration required |
Please note that these estimates are based on hypothetical scenarios and actual costs may vary depending on the specifics of your case. We’ll provide a free on-site assessment to find out the actual cost of the service.
